Devils Grove Disc Golf opens

LEWISTON — Owner/designer Alex Olsen announces that the Devils Grove Disc Golf Course, 455 Grove St., is open in Lewiston with a full 18-hole disc golf course and practice basket. Cold winter fuels demand for firewood in Maine

WINDHAM (AP) — Summer isn’t officially here yet but Maine residents who heat their homes with wood are already thinking about next winter. Mark Killinger, owner of Atlantic Firewood, and other firewood dealers say homeowners are calling early and ordering more wood than normal, while memories of last winter’s brutal cold are still fresh. Maine mercury contamination trial set to start

BANGOR (AP) — A federal trial is beginning this week to determine whether a chemical company responsible for dumping mercury from a closed plant in Orrington will be required to clean contamination from along the banks of the Penobscot River and the mouth of Penobscot Bay.
